[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[POLL] Use compat.el in Org? (was: Useful package? Compat.el)
From: |
Ihor Radchenko |
Subject: |
[POLL] Use compat.el in Org? (was: Useful package? Compat.el) |
Date: |
Fri, 27 Jan 2023 13:23:40 +0000 |
Timothy <tecosaur@gmail.com> writes:
> I’ve recently come across an interesting looking library available on ELPA,
> <https://git.sr.ht/~pkal/compat>. I’m thinking in future this could allow us
> to
> both use newer features and also support older versions of Emacs, e.g.
>
> Org 10.X is developed for Emacs 28.1 and newer, but supports Emacs 24.3 and
> newer with compat.el.
>
> Just tossing this out as an idea :)
I have recently been contacted by the current compat.el maintainer
asking if we are willing to adapt compat.el in Org.
Pros:
1. We will have less headache maintaining org-compat.el.
2. We will get an ability to use functions and macros from newer Emacs
versions almost for free.
Cons:
1. If compat.el happens to lack support of some function, we will need
to contribute to compat.el directly and synchronize Org releases with
compat.el releases.
WDYT?
--
Ihor Radchenko // yantar92,
Org mode contributor,
Learn more about Org mode at <https://orgmode.org/>.
Support Org development at <https://liberapay.com/org-mode>,
or support my work at <https://liberapay.com/yantar92>